Augusta – Benjamin W. Wilson, 87, of Livermore, died late Wednesday evening at the Alfond Center for Health in Augusta. He was born in Woodstock, ME, Nov. 9, 1935, a son of Shirley and Clara (Estes) Wilson. He was a veteran of the United States Army and worked as a truck driver, first for Ferland’s Dairy in Mexico and later at DeCoster Egg Farms for 25 years. He most recently had worked as a truck driver for the Town of Livermore. In 1966, he married Linda Timberlake and the made their home in Livermore for over 50 years. He enjoyed gardening and spending time with his son with whom he had a very close relationship.
He is survived by his wife, Linda of Livermore; son, Mark Wilson and wife Jo of Oakland; grandson, Michael and 2 great-grandchildren.
